Bring recent pay stubs, proof of residence, and your driver's license. If you're self-employed, two years of tax returns speed things up.
Don't fixate on the payment. A $500 payment on a 4-year loan is a much better deal than a $400 payment on a 7-year loan. Josh will walk you through the math.
